Output 45181f19806176fcc6edb09c4488164d9c1080e473e509f2968175ccead0d26b:30

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bec577d2266dad4d4346ea4e170eecc1478052a7 OP_EQUAL
address
3K5isK4X8tNuNV5LV4UJMA6YeDCuc2fqgs
transaction
45181f19806176fcc6edb09c4488164d9c1080e473e509f2968175ccead0d26b